Architecting the Future: Vice President of Platform Product Management (AI & Ecosystems)

Are you ready to lead a global tech titan through its most significant evolution yet by bridging the physical and digital worlds? Trimble is seeking a visionary executive to transform our expansive product portfolio into a unified, AI-first ecosystem that powers the world’s most essential industries, delivering a cohesive, high-value experience that redefines how our customers operate on a global scale.

What Makes This Role Great:

This is a rare opportunity to serve as the chief architect of Trimble’s digital transformation, moving beyond individual applications to build a shared platform powerhouse. You will have the unique mandate to redefine the product development lifecycle for an AI-first paradigm, overseeing the strategic execution of Trimble Connect and driving common capabilities across a high-growth, global matrixed organization.

Key Exciting Responsibilities

  • Platform Transformation:Lead the strategic shift from products and apps to a shared platform ecosystem. Develop and evangelize a roadmap for common services that provides a clear "path to value" for Trimble’s autonomous business units.

  • Trimble Connect: As the centerpiece of our collaborative and unifying common data environment, ensure maximization of Trimble Connect’s value and impact globally.

  • AI-First Product and UX Leadership: Transform the product management function to operate in an AI-first paradigm. This includes redefining the product development lifecycle for AI, accelerating time to customer validation and to market validation for new capabilities

  • Unified Roadmap:Develop a modern, novel approach to rigorous and ongoing capital allocation and prioritization across a large product portfolio, ensuring an optimal balance across new and mature products.

  • Capability Driven Adoption and Relationship Management: Act as the primary driver for platform approaches and requirements across Trimble’s sectors. Build and foster deep, collaborative relationships with product and engineering leadership to adopt and create common platform capabilities.Navigate a complex, highly matrixed organization to create buy-in, clearly articulating the strategic trade-offs and long-term value of a platform and capability-driven approach.

  • Metrics and Analytics-Driven Governance:Establish and track clear KPIs to measure platform impact, including adoption rates, internal customer satisfaction, speed-to-market improvements for sectors, and platform-driven revenue growth.

  • Strategy and Product Marketing:Partner with GTM and marketing teams to define the value proposition of the Trimble Platform. Ensure that platform capabilities are effectively translated into competitive advantages in the marketplace.

  • GTM Execution:Collaborate on pricing, packaging, and commercialization strategies for platform-enabled services, ensuring they align with broader objectives.

Essential Skills & Experience

  • Minimum of 10 years in Product Management leadership within a large B2B SaaS or platform-centric environment.

  • Proven track record of leading major organizational transformations, specifically moving from multi-product portfolios to unified platform models.

  • Demonstrated experience evolving a product organization to be AI-first, including deep knowledge of AI deployment and monitoring.

  • Exceptional ability to influence and build buy-in within a complex, highly matrixed, or decentralized corporate structure.

  • Strong background in GTM strategy, product marketing, and capital allocation for large product portfolios.

Bonus Points For

  • Advanced degree (MBA) or technical degree in Computer Science or Engineering.

  • Deep familiarity with modern cloud architecture, data lakehouses, and large-scale API ecosystems.

  • Experience in conflict resolution across competing business units with a service-oriented mindset toward internal customers.

Logistics

Location: Westminster, CO, In-Office

Travel Requirement: 25%
